PORTUGAL VS ALGERIA PREVIEW & PREDICTION

One week before the opening match of the FIFA World Cup 2018 in Russia, the European champion uses the last chance for a test. At the Estádio da Luz in Lisbon Portugal receives the national team of Algeria. The European champion currently does not seem to be in World Cup form. Of the last five internationals Selecao Portuguesa could win only one. And even this victory came just barely: Until the 92nd Minute had been back in the test against Egypt with 0: 1, as Ronaldo with two goals until the 94th minute, the game still for the European champions turned. Portugal drew three times during this period: against the USA, Tunisia and Belgium. In addition came a 0-3 home defeat against the Netherlands. Can Portugal get some tailwind for their first World Cup match against Spain with a win against Algeria?

Portugal:

The European champion is currently preparing for the World Cup in the Cidade de Futebol near Lisbon. Portugal had in the World Cup qualifier in the group B ran. There was a head-to-head race with Switzerland right from the start. Ronaldo and Co. had lost the first group game in Switzerland. After that you could all win the next eight games in a row. On the final day of the match, the showdown against the Swiss, who had won the first nine qualifying matches, was celebrated. The Swiss would have been in Lisbon a point to win the group. But Portugal secured themselves with a 2-0 victory, the direct World Cup ticket in the end only due to the better goal difference. In the ten qualifying games, the Portguies had scored 32 goals and conceded only four goals. The World Cup in Russia means for the reigning European champion the fifth participation in a final round.

With 15 goals in qualifying, Cristiano Ronaldo once again played a large part in the success of his team. Another star of hope is young star André Silva, who moved from FC Porto to AC Milan this summer for 38 million euros. He is considered in the national team as designated successor to CR7. As with the European Championship, coach Fernando Santos continues to focus on defensive stability and good organization. But the defense of the former Champions League winner Pepe is slowly getting old. Santos had taken over the team in September 2014.

Since winning the European Championship title, the Portuguese suffered four defeats: In addition to losing to Switzerland lost two friendly matches, at home against Sweden and the Netherlands. In addition, they lost to the Confed Cup on penalties against Chile. Otherwise you could win 16 international matches and played four draws. The Confederations Cup finished the coach of Santos in third place. Portugal will face Spain, Morocco and Iran at Group B World Cup. Directly in the first group match, it comes to a duel against fellow favorite Spain. With Raphael Guerreiro of Borussia Dortmund is only a professional from the Bundesliga in the squad of the European champion.

Algeria:

After a 9-2 victory over Tanzania in the second round of the World Cup qualifiers played Algeria in Group B of the continental association CAF against Nigeria, Zambia and Cameroon for a ticket to Russia. With only one win, a draw and four defeats, the Algerian national football team finished at the bottom of the last place in the group. In six games, the desert fox scored six goals and scored ten goals. It was Algeria in 2014 in the fourth World Cup participation in history still came in the second round and was there only extremely scarce with 1: 2 after extra time against the eventual champion Germany excreted. In October 2017, Rabah Madjer became Algerian national coach for the fourth time. At Bayern you should not have so good memories of Madjer: The Algerian shot the FC Porto 1987 in the final of the national champion cup with a Hackentor to victory against the German record champions.

After the 2-3 home defeat of Algeria against the Cape Verde Islands last Friday, Madjer is facing the dismissal. It was the third consecutive bankruptcy for the Fennecs. If rumors and hints from Algerian Football Association President Kheireddine Zetchi are voiced, Madjer will look after the Algerian national football team against Portugal for the last time. His successor seems already to be established with Rabah Saadane. But also names like Carlos Queiroz or Vahid Halilhodzic are traded. As bad as the Algerians have been in recent months, they are not actually playing in the national team but stars such as Mahrez and Slimani (both Leicester City), Ghoulam (SSC Naples) or Bentableb (FC Schalke 04).
